Re: C2D Overclocking Guide for Beginners
I've updated the BIOS now and it seems that the OC is working. I actually updated the BIOS but downgraded it to 0614 as I read at www.xtremesystems.org that it was the best OC BIOS version. ..Shame on me!!
So, ok. Its working now but why now? Why did't it work with v.0614? |

Re: C2D Overclocking Guide for Beginners
It may have been the best version for whatever they were doing, but, trust me, I tested them all when I was writing this, and on the P5B, it was always best to have the later BIOSes.
It could also be to do with some of the other hardware that you have, that doesnt play nice with that particular BIOS. Swings and roundabouts, glad you sorted it

Re: C2D Overclocking Guide for Beginners
Hi, I'm using an e4300 on an Asus P5NSLI with a Thermaltake BigTyp 120 cooler. I'm pretty sure I followed your guuide step by step, and have managed to get some results, but they were very poor.
I actually got stuck on the "OC for beginners" part of the guide. My problem is that I can't get an FSB frequency higher than 275MHz, if I try 300 or higher, upon reboot at first my screen doesn't even turn on, then it reboots again, and on the POST I get the message "MBO is now in safe mode, please re-setting CPU or RAM frequency in CMOS setup" (XD motherboard english roxx ).I've tried upping Vcore and RAM voltages but with no success, it's always the same thing.
